            This case is before me on a Petition for Assessment of Civil Penalty filed by the Secretary of Labor (“Secretary”) on behalf of her Mine Safety and Health Administration (“MSHA”), against Consolidation Coal Company (“Consol”), pursuant to section 105 of the Federal Mine Safety and Health Act of 1977, 30 U.S.C. § 815. The Secretary seeks civil penalties totaling $1,934.00 for two alleged violations of her mandatory safety standards.


            A hearing was held in Kingsport, Tennessee. The parties’ Post-hearing Briefs are of record. Footnote For the reasons set forth below, I VACATE the citations and DISMISS the Petition.

II. Factual Background


            Consol owns and operates Buchanan No. 1, an underground coal mine in Buchanan County, Virginia. Richard Perkins, a float foreman, was acting as the section foreman for the “O” panel longwall development section of Buchanan No. 1 on the midnight (“owl”) shift beginning at 11:30 p.m. on November 1, 2006, and ending on the morning of November 2. Tr. 134. He provided an unrefuted account of the crew’s activities during the first half of the shift. The “O” panel had two roof bolting machines and a continuous miner operating on the working section, and was accessed by four entries. Tr. 138, 140; Ex. G-10. Early in the shift, Perkins completed an on-shift examination of the “O” panel section. Tr. 144; Ex. R-1. The left side roof bolter, parked in the number 2 entry, was down for maintenance during the entire shift. Tr. 138. During Perkins’ on-shift, he identified as a hazardous condition a wide place in the 2 left break, and corrected it by having a crib built and three timbers set. Tr. 144-46; Ex. R-1, R-2 at I. No other hazardous conditions were identified during Perkins’ on-shift examination. During the first four hours of the shift, the crew performed maintenance tasks of cleaning coal accumulations from areas on the section, washing equipment, and completing permissibility and dust parameter checks on the continuous miner. Tr. 134-35. They rock dusted in the number 3 belt entry. Tr. 164; Ex. R-1.


             The crew began producing coal at 4:05 a.m. Tr. 135. First, they mined in the crosscut between the number 2 and number 3 entries, and then they advanced in the face of the number 4 entry. Tr. 152-53. Perkins conducted a pre-shift examination of the “O” panel section from 4:30 to 5:15. Tr. 148. No hazardous conditions were identified or corrected as a result of his examination. Tr. 147-49; Ex. R-1. At some point after completion of Perkins’ pre-shift exam, near the end of the shift, a roof fall occurred in the number 4 entry where the continuous miner was being operated. A conveyor lead was severed, a methane monitor was dislodged, and a methane sensor was damaged on the miner, resulting in a mining shutdown on the section.

Tr. 25-27, 157-58. There were at least 16 inches of fallen rock covering the miner’s monitor and sensors. Tr. 27. The crew’s electrician temporarily spliced the damaged cable, in order to back the miner out of its location to a safer place where it could be repaired. Tr. 157-59; see Tr. 103.


            Supervisory MSHA Inspector David Fowler was assigned to conduct a regular inspection of Buchanan No. 1 in the latter hours of the shift, the morning of November 2. He had been conducting inspections of the mine since September 2000. Tr. 22-24. Fowler’s employment at MSHA spans over 25 years, and has included experience as an accident investigator. Tr. 24. Subsequent to the subject November 2 inspection, he became the supervisor of the MSHA Field Office in Princeton, West Virginia. Tr. 22-24. Fowler was accompanied by MSHA inspector trainee, Garnee Deel, and Consol’s then chief ventilation supervisor, Archie Ruble. Tr. 84-85, 201-02. The inspection team entered the mine at approximately 6:45, reached the “O” panel section at about 7:50, and remained on the section for roughly one hour. Tr. 25, 85. When they arrived on the section, the owl crew was in the process of rock dusting in the number 3 entry to the face in number 4, and the continuous miner was being repaired in the number 4 entry. Tr. 86-88, 185-86, 211-14.


            As a result of his observations, in addition to the two citations at issue in this proceeding, Fowler issued several citations for hazardous conditions on the section: (1) Citation No. 6624107 for loose and hanging ribs on four inby corners located in the number 2 entry (Ex. G-3); (2) Citation No. 6624106 for inadequate air circulation (Ex. G-4); (3) Citation No. 6624110 for a loose light and improper splice of the conveyor cable on the continuous miner (Ex. G-5); (4) Citation No. 6624115 for a non-functioning methane monitor on the continuous miner (Ex. G-6); and Citation No. 6624111 for loose coal and hydraulic oil accumulations in and on areas of the continuous miner (Ex. G-7). Footnote

                        2. Fact of Violation


            In order to establish a violation of one of her safety standards, the Secretary must prove that the violation occurred “by a preponderance of the credible evidence.” Keystone Coal Mining Corp., 17 FMSHRC 1819, 1838 (Nov. 1998) (citing Garden Creek Pocahontas Co., 11 FMSHRC 2148, 2152 (Nov. 1989)).           


            While the Commission has held that a violation of section 75.400 occurs when an accumulation of combustible materials exists, it has recognized that “some spillage of combustible materials may be inevitable in mining operations” and that “[w]hether a spillage constitutes an accumulation under the standard is a question, at least in part, of size and amount.” Old Ben Coal Co., 1 FMSHRC 1954, 1958 (Dec. 1979) (“Old Ben I”). The Commission has also rejected the rule that evidence of depth and extent is a necessary prerequisite to establishing a violation of 30 C.F.R. § 75.400, holding that, subject to challenge before an administrative law judge, “an accumulation exists where the quantity of combustible materials is such that, in the judgment of the authorized representative of the Secretary, it likely could cause or propagate a fire or explosion if an ignition source were present.” Old Ben Coal Co., 2 FMSHRC 2806, 2807-08 (Oct. 1980) (“Old Ben II”). In pointing out the obviousness of the prohibition against permitting loose coal to accumulate, the Tenth Circuit has interpreted the mandate to require reasonably prompt clean up, “with all convenient speed.” Utah Power & Light Co. v. Sec’y of Labor, 951 F.2d 292, 295, n. 11 (10th Cir. 1991). The judgment of an MSHA inspector as to whether a violation existed is subject to review under “an objective test of whether a reasonably prudent person, familiar with the mining industry and the protective purposes of the standard, would have recognized the hazardous condition that the regulation seeks to prevent.” Utah Power & Light Co., 12 FMSHRC 965, 968 (May 1990), aff’d, 951 F.2d 292 (10th Cir. 1991) (citation omitted).


            Inspector Fowler’s account of what he observed on the section is at odds with Ruble and Perkins’ observations, as well as Perkins’ account of the crew’s activities on the night owl shift. As a threshold matter, Consol challenges Fowler’s placement of equipment and locations of alleged violations on the diagram of the section, asserting that the inspector was off by one crosscut. Ruble corroborated Perkins’ layout of the section, diagramed by Perkins within a few days of the inspection. Moreover, Fowler had no recollection of having inspected the “O” panel section on October 31, contrary to the evidence. Because Fowler had not reviewed Deel’s notes prior to testifying and failed to recall the prior inspection just two days before, and because there is no other evidence of his version, I credit Consol’s account of the section layout. See Tr. 85-86, 201, 229. Applying the same reasoning to the discrepancy in the testimonies of Fowler and Perkins, that they discussed the alleged violations before Perkins and the owl crew left the section, I am not persuaded that any conversation took place based on Fowler’s recollection alone and, therefore, credit Consol’s account. I note that these findings, rather than dispositive of whether the accumulations were impermissible, go to the credibility of the inspector’s overall testimony, in light of the absence of notes to refresh his recollection or corroboration by other testimony. Footnote


            Going back to Fowler’s earlier October 31 inspection, during which Ruble also traveled with him, it can reasonably be inferred that the accumulations cited on November 2 had not been present because Fowler had not issued any citations. Perkins’ testimony that the crew cleaned the section and its equipment, including the feeder and continuous miner, during the first half of midnight shift in the early hours of November 2 is credible and, indeed, essentially unchallenged by the Secretary. Likewise, the Secretary has not refuted that, while the crew was cleaning and performing maintenance on the equipment, the feeder had only been run long enough to dump the coal and rock that had been cleaned off the section and machinery. When the inspection team arrived on the “O” panel section at about 7:50, the crew had been mining for less than four hours, and the rock fall that caused the continuous miner to be shut down prematurely further minimized the active mining on the owl shift. I find, based on credible testimony of the crew’s maintenance and cleaning activities, and Consol’s policy of washing equipment in the first two hours and, again, in the last two hours of a shift, that when the owl crew began cutting coal at 4:05, the section and equipment were clean of coal and oil accumulations. Therefore, I further find that the accumulations at issue on the haulageways and equipment occurred between 4:05 and sometime prior to 7:50, rather than two, three, or four days earlier, as the Secretary suggests.


            Fowler and Ruble both attested to having observed coal and oil accumulations in the cited areas, but gave significantly conflicting accounts of the nature of the accumulations. The Secretary holds the view that Fowler cited impermissible accumulations that had existed for several days, whereas Consol challenges Fowler’s assessment of the extensiveness and duration, contending that the accumulations constituted permissible spillage incidental to the normal mining cycle on the midnight shift. Recognizing that the Secretary bears the ultimate burden of proof, and that the resolution of the issue in controversy involves a question of degree, the Secretary’s evidence falls short of establishing that the accumulations were in violation of section 75.400.

 

            Fowler took no measurements of the coal accumulations in any of the areas that he cited on the section, but made rough estimates. He was asked to describe in great detail, from sheer memory alone, except for review of the citation, itself, events that took place a year earlier.


            When Perkins conducted his pre-shift examination of the section between 4:30 and 5:15, the crew had only been actively mining since 4:05. Given my finding that mining commenced on a clean section, Perkins’ testimony, that he observed no coal or oil accumulations at the feeder or coal accumulated along the ribs or adjacent intersection, is reasonable and wholly credible. I also fully credit his testimony that the continuous miner had been washed a second time before being operated in the number 4 entry, that active mining did not commence in that entry until after his pre-shift exam had been completed, and that he observed no coal accumulations in the crosscut between the number 3 and 4 entries.  

 

            Perkins and Ruble’s testimony establish that the section was damp from washing equipment during the owl shift, especially at the feeder where water tended to collect due to a slight grade in the number 3 entry. The shuttle cars tracked the water back and forth throughout the entry and, at least some of this very soft, rutted, black bottom could have been mistaken for coal accumulations, most notably at the feeder and the adjacent intersection where the shuttle cars change out. See Tr. 145, 155, 194-97, 227-28, 234-36. Even Fowler acknowledged that the soft bottom on the section can become rutted, and did not deny that it was comprised of dirt or rock, rather than coal. Tr. 92. He also acknowledged that shuttle cars traveling through the section during production tend to be overloaded and spill. Tr. 61. He also stated that feeders and miners “most always” have coal on them. Tr. 118. Furthermore, Fowler, himself, minimized the nature of the hydraulic oil accumulation, by admitting that he had included it in the citation in order to light a fire under Consol to get a previously ordered part that would fix the problem. Tr. 63. Again, given the limited amount of mining that occurred that night, the fact that the Secretary has not refuted that a second cleaning and rock dusting occurred before the end of the shift, and because the area cited at the feeder -- soft, damp and rutted -- was the dumping point and change-out area for the overloaded shuttle cars coming from the face, I conclude that the coal accumulations in the number 3 entry amounted to permissible spillage incidental to the normal mining. Therefore, the Secretary has not established that an impermissible accumulation of coal and float coal dust was present on the section.

   

            Likewise, Ruble’s testimony respecting the crosscut between the number 3 and 4 entries and the loading point in the vicinity of where the continuous miner had been operating in the number 4 entry before the rock fall, and the drag-off caused by the loaded shuttle cars passing under the check curtain, was compelling and unrebutted. Fowler, himself, even testified that some of what he observed was spillage from loading the shuttle cars. Tr. 91. The owl crew had been producing coal immediately prior to the inspector’s arrival on the section until the rock fall on the continuous miner. Tr. 111-12. The miner had been removed from the hazardous area and was in the process of being repaired. The evidence supports a conclusion that the coal was incidental to the normal mining cycle on the shift that night. Accordingly, I conclude that the Secretary has failed to prove by a preponderance of the evidence that an impermissible accumulation of combustible materials existed on the section at the time of inspection and, therefore, no violation of section 75.400 has been established.

                        2. Fact of Violation


            As previously stated, the Secretary must prove by a preponderance of the evidence that the operator violated one of her safety standards. Keystone, 17 FMSHRC at 1838.


            A violation of section 75.360 occurs when hazardous conditions are not recorded in the pre-shift record book. Enlow Fork Mining Co., 19 FMSHRC 5, 14 (Jan. 1997) (stating that section 75.360 “requires that a preshift examiner ‘examine for hazardous conditions.’”); see also generally Nat’l Mining Ass’n v. MSHA, 116 F.3d 520, 539-40 (D.C. Cir. 1997) (upholding the validity of 30 C.F.R. 75.360 and discussing the regulation’s emphasis on identifying current hazardous conditions). However, there is no violation where the hazardous condition did not exist at the time of the pre-shift examination. Jim Walter Res., Inc., 29 FMSHRC 212, 226 (Mar. 2007) (ALJ).


            The purpose of the pre-shift examination is to “prevent loss of life and injury” resulting from hazards at mines. S. Rep. No. 91-411, at 71 (1969), reprinted in Senate Subcomm. on Labor, Comm. on Human Res., Part I Legislative History of the Federal Coal Mine Health and Safety Act of 1969, at 183 (1975). The Commission has long recognized that “[t]he preshift examination requirement ‘is of fundamental importance in assuring a safe working environment underground.’” Enlow Fork, 19 FMSHRC at 15 (quoting Buck Creek Coal Co., 17 FMSHRC 8, 15 (Jan. 1995)).


            I have credited Consol’s account of the “O” Panel section layout, and made findings that the section was clean of accumulations when active mining began at 4:05, and that any accumulations found on the section occurred between 4:05 and sometime prior to the inspection team’s 7:50 arrival on the section.


            The Secretary alleges that the hazardous rib conditions in the number 2 entry and coal and oil accumulations on the right side of the section were present during Perkins’ pre-shift examination because of evidence that the conditions had existed prior to the midnight shift. Fowler’s account of what he observed, however, without corroboration, is particularly suspect, because of inconsistencies in his ability to recall some important details of his inspection. His accounts of how long the accumulations had existed at the feeder and on the continuous miner were vague. Tr. 44-45. He could not remember the location of the water sprays on the feeder. Tr. 108-09. He was unclear as to whether the miner was energized while it was being repaired. Tr. 87-88. He was unable to recall where he took the air reading behind the line curtain in the vicinity of the continuous miner. Tr. 90. He had a problem remembering the location where the miner cable ran from the power center up the number 3 entry and into the crosscut between entries 3 and 4. Tr. 97-98. Even more troubling is his inability to recall having inspected the same section just two days prior, especially in light of his opinion that some of the alleged hazards pre-dated that prior inspection. Tr. 85-86. As was discussed fully above, Fowler did not have the benefit of actual measurements or his own inspection notes, and did not review Deel’s inspection notes prior to testifying. Tr. 84-85. Also, as has been previously emphasized, Deel’s notes and/or his testimony would have been helpful in establishing the circumstances surrounding the allegations.


            The evidence establishes that the active working section had been cleaned extensively prior to active mining, which had only begun 25 minutes prior to when Perkins began his pre-shift exam at 4:30. Perkins testified credibly that he examined the areas cited, and did not observe any bad ribs or fallen timber. This testimony is bolstered by Perkins’ handling of a hazard that he had encountered during his earlier on-shift exam -- the wide place in the number 2 break -- for which he had a crib built and timbers set. It is reasonable to assume that he would have acted similarly had he encountered the rib conditions that he has been charged with overlooking. The Secretary has not rebutted that rib conditions can change suddenly and drastically, especially in very deep mines such as Buchanan No. 1. The evidence in its entirety only establishes that the rib conditions observed by Fowler and Ruble, some not readily apparent in Consol’s view, existed at the time of inspection -- some three hours after Perkins’ had completed his pre-shift examination -- but not that they were present when Perkins examined the number 2 entry. I am unwilling to conclude, without more, based on Perkins’ failure to examine behind the roof bolter covers, that the ribs had rolled at that time, or that Perkins’ overall pre-shift examination was lacking. The Secretary’s account of events has simply not been supported by the evidence in its entirety.


            The Secretary has also failed to prove that Perkins neglected to report coal, float coal dust, or hydraulic oil accumulations on the right side of the section or on its equipment as a result of his pre-shift examination. Perkins gave credible testimony that he did not observe the alleged accumulations while he was conducting his pre-shift exam, and I credit Ruble’s testimony that the accumulations observed during Fowler’s inspection were fresh and appreciably less extensive than alleged by the Secretary. This conclusion is consistent with my finding that mining began at 4:05 on a clean section, as well as credible evidence that mining in number 4 did not commence until after Perkins had already examined the entry. Therefore, I find that coal and oil accumulations were not present during Perkins’ pre-shift examination, and it must be concluded that no violation of section 75.360 occurred.
